Description of problem: diveintopython-txt only contains /usr/share/applications/fedora-diveintopython-txt.desktop /usr/share/diveintopython-txt/ Version-Release number of selected component (if applicable): diveintopython-txt-5.4-6.fc9 How reproducible: Always Steps to Reproduce: 1. yum install diveintopython-txt 2. rpm -ql diveintopython-txt Actual results: diveintopython-txt should provide or pull dependency for /usr/share/diveintopython-txt/diveintopython.txt as the desktop file tries to xdg-open /usr/share/diveintopython-txt/diveintopython.txt Expected results: clicking the desktop file should open the document Additional info: imo, diveintopython doesnt need to provide .desktop file, especially for the -txt and -html where it will possibly start up gedit/firefox which might not be desirable. Plus the other diveintopython-* provides .desktop files with the same Name tag, and it can confuses users. Furthermore, iirc, .desktop files are meant for launching applications, not documents.
It uses xdg-open so that shouldn't be an issue it will default to whatever is the preference on the desktop you are using. When I went through the review process I was allowed the desktop files so I have left them in there. I personally don't see a reason to remove them. The issues are fixed in the next version btw.